the key is this warning:
SAWarning: mapper Mapper|ApplicationSchedule|Select object creating an
alias for the given selectable - use Class attributes for queries.
so in this case the polymorphic_on column is no longer recognized
since its against the underlying selectable, which has been replaced.
change your selectable to:
select_application_schedules = select([table_application_schedules],
table_application_schedules.c.dateDeactivated == None).alias()
SQLA should be making a better choice here. Either not allow the auto-
alias() thing, or somehow figure out the right thing to do. The
latter is not trivial at the moment.

> Hello. SA newbie here.
>
> I'm using selectable in a mapper for the first time and I'm having
> problems. From what I understand, you can create a select object and
> use it in place of a Table object in a mapper. For example, if you
> have these two objects:
>
> schedTable = Table('schedule', metadata, Column('id', Integer,
> primary_key=True), Column('aDate', Date))
> schedSelect = select([schedTable])
>
> The following two mapper lines will result in a ScheduleClass that
> works exactly the same as the other:
>
> mapper(ScheduleClass, schedTable)
> mapper(ScheduleClass, schedSelect)
>
> Following this logic, I tried to update one of my mappings with a
> select object and received errors. To see what happened, I've wrote
> some simplified code that reproduces the problem and pasted it here:
>
> http://pastebin.com/d5467be2f
>
> When you run the code it succesfully creates the mapper and even
> inserts new objects correctly into the database, but when trying to
> retrieve data it throws the following error:
>
> sqlalchemy.exc.NoSuchColumnError: "Could not locate column in row for
> column 'scheduleType'"
>
> at the following line of code:
>
> schedules = session.query(ApplicationSchedule).all()
>
> What am I doing wrong / don't understand about SQLAlchemy?
